How To Fix /IWBEP/CM_MGW_SUB002 - Update failed for Subscription '&1'


SAP Error Message - Details

  • Message type: E = Error

  • Message class: /IWBEP/CM_MGW_SUB -

  • Message number: 002

  • Message text: Update failed for Subscription '&1'

  • What is the cause and solution for SAP error message /IWBEP/CM_MGW_SUB002 - Update failed for Subscription '&1' ?

    The SAP error message /IWBEP/CM_MGW_SUB002 Update failed for Subscription '&1' typically occurs in the context of SAP Gateway and OData services when there is an issue with updating a subscription in the system. This error can arise due to various reasons, and understanding the cause is essential for troubleshooting.

    Possible Causes:

    1. Invalid Subscription ID: The subscription ID referenced in the error message may not exist or may have been deleted.
    2. Authorization Issues: The user or service account attempting to perform the update may not have the necessary permissions to modify the subscription.
    3. Data Integrity Issues: There may be issues with the data being sent in the update request, such as missing required fields or invalid data formats.
    4. Service Configuration Issues: The OData service may not be properly configured, leading to failures in processing the update request.
    5. Backend System Errors: There could be issues in the backend system (e.g., database errors, connectivity issues) that prevent the update from being processed.

    Solutions:

    1. Check Subscription ID: Verify that the subscription ID provided in the error message is valid and exists in the system.
    2. Review Authorizations: Ensure that the user or service account has the necessary authorizations to perform updates on subscriptions.
    3. Validate Input Data: Check the data being sent in the update request for completeness and correctness. Ensure that all required fields are included and that data types match expected formats.
    4. Examine Service Configuration: Review the configuration of the OData service to ensure it is set up correctly. Check for any inconsistencies or misconfigurations.
    5. Check Backend Logs: Look at the backend system logs for any errors or warnings that may provide additional context about the failure.
    6. Debugging: If possible, use debugging tools to trace the execution of the update request and identify where it fails.

    Related Information:

    • SAP Notes: Check SAP Notes for any known issues or patches related to the error message. SAP frequently updates its knowledge base with solutions to common problems.
    • Transaction Codes: Use transaction codes like /IWFND/MAINT_SERVICE to manage OData services and check their status.
    • SAP Community: Engage with the SAP Community forums to see if other users have encountered similar issues and what solutions they found effective.
    • Documentation: Refer to the official SAP documentation for OData services and SAP Gateway for detailed information on subscription management and error handling.

    By systematically addressing these areas, you should be able to identify the root cause of the error and implement an appropriate solution.
